ORDER

This petition has been filed seeking to direct the 2nd respondent to consider and dispose of the petitioner's representation dated 03.06.2024 and issue the nativity / residence certificate within a time frame to be fixed by this Court.

2. It is the case of the petitioner that the petitioner is a permanent resident of Puducherry by birth, through her parents and ancestry. She was born on 26.07.2006 at Government Maternity Hospital, Puducherry and had received Birth Certificate No.PM14934040422M, issued by the Pondicherry Municipality. Due to her father's job and his frequent transfer, she did her schooling at various parts of India and that she is having her permanent address at Pondicherry till date. The petitioner intend to pursue higher education in Puducherry and it is mandatory to submit a nativity / residence certificate, along with Nationality, Caste (OBC) and Telugu Speaking 2/4

Minority Certificates to the concerned Educational Authorities at Puducherry. The petitioner has given a representation dated 03.06.2024 to the 2nd respondent for issuance of nativity / residence certificate to her, however, the same was not considered by the respondents. Hence, the petitioner is before this Court.

3. Heard both sides and perused the materials placed on record.

4. Considering the limited relief sought for in the writ petition, this Court without going into the merits of the case directs the third respondent to consider the representation dated 03.06.2024 of the petitioner and pass appropriate orders on merits and in accordance with law within a period of three we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order.

5. With the aforesaid directions, this writ petition is disposed of. No Costs.
